Default Question re sliding hatch

Can someone explain to me how the sliding hatch actually works, and more importantly, how I can "tighten" up the feel of the slide? I think i saw some kind of insert between the hatch flanges and the foredeck ? Is this replaceable and where could I get it?

Default Re: Question re sliding hatch

Fillet...the way it works is the flange on each side is "captured" by the groove it slides in (everytime somebody new gets on my boat, they wanna LIFT that lid >:()....if there is extra play in the movement of the lid, try attaching a long "shim" along the side edge of the lid, just inside the groove.... 1/2" Starboard ripped to thickness just less than "slop" would be great for this as it is "slick" an won't bind....if you attach w/screws, countersink ovalhead screws so no scraping ;)...if I understand your problem, this outta get it... :)
